Planning and Zoning Department

The Fluvanna County Planning and Zoning Department provides numerous services that relate to the well being and orderly development of the community.  The three primary areas of responsibility include current planning, long range planning, and code enforcement.

The Planning and Zoning Department is dedicated to efficiently and effectively serving the citizens and stakeholders of Fluvanna County primarily through these diverse services and products.

Human Resources Home

The Human Resources Department provides services to Fluvanna County employees, Constitutional Officers, the Circuit Court, the Department of Social Services, the Registrar's Office, the Sheriff's Office,  the Fluvanna County Public Library, and the general public.

Primary areas of responsibility include classification and compensation, recruitment, performance management, employee relations, employee development, policy design and administration, and benefits administration.

Finance

The Finance Department is responsible for processing County accounts payables, payroll for County employees, maintaining current general ledger for all County accounts, financial reporting, purchasing activity for the County, grant management, risk management, maintaining and issuance of all debt. Finance also works closely with the County Administrator in preparing and maintaining the County capital improvements plan and the annual budget.
